Your role

Key responsibilities are as follows:

  • Assist in calculating sales incentives, ensuring accuracy and compliance with guidelines.
  • Support the preparation and distribution of monthly reports on Sales Force Effectiveness (SFE) KPIs, including sales performance and productivity metrics.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to gather data and insights for reporting.
  • Conduct data analysis to identify trends and opportunities for improvement in sales performance.
  • Maintain detailed records and documentation related to incentive calculations and reporting.
  • Assist in developing and enhancing reporting tools and dashboards.
  • Participate in team meetings and contribute to discussions on operational improvements.
  • Perform ad-hoc analyses and support special projects as needed.

About you

The ideal candidate will have:

  • A Bachelor’s degree in business administration, finance, marketing, or a related field (recent graduates are encouraged to apply).
  • Strong analytical skills with proficiency in Microsoft Excel; experience with data visualization tools is a plus.
  • Excellent attention to detail and ability to work with large datasets.
  • Strong organizational skills and ability to manage multiple tasks and deadlines.
  • Effective communication skills, both written and verbal.
  • A team-oriented mindset with a willingness to learn and collaborate.
  • A basic understanding of sales processes and performance metrics is a plus but not required.
